Messerschmitt Bf 109 E-3/E-4

Engine

DB 601 A-1 with Neuem (“new”) Supercharger, Full Throttle Height = 4500 m @ 1.30 ata/2400 rpm

on ground
RPM[U/min] pressure[ata]
Emergency power = 1' 2500 1,40
Short power = 5' 2400 1,30
Increased cont. power = 30' 2300 1,23
max. cont. power = d 2200 1,15
econ. power 1500 0,75

Propeller Pitch Actuation

  • Bf 109 E-3
    • Only manual propeller pitch actuation
  • Bf 109 E-4
    • Manual and automatic propeller pitch actuation
    • At taxiing, start, economy-flight and landing use manual pitch(deactivate auto-mode and use buttons to increase/decrease Propeller pitch).
    • For all other flight modes use the automatic.

Start

  • Fuel Cock On
  • Prop pitch Full fine 12:00
  • Prop Pitch Manual Variable Pitch
  • Start

Warm up

  • Min Oil Temp 40C
  • Min Coolant temp 40C

Take off

  • 1.30 ata 2400 rpm
  • WEP 1.40 ata 2500 rpm (1 Min Clockwork timer)

Climb

  • 1.23/2300rpm
  • Climb at 250Kmh to 600m then 240Kmh to 8000m then 220-200Kmh to ceiling
  • 5Min Rating 1.30/2400

Landing

  • Prop Full Fine 12:00

Rad Usage

  • Use Oil and Coolant Rads as required to control Coolant and Oil Temp.
  • Use 3/4 Coolant Rad and 3/4 Oil Cooler at climb settings.
  • Half open is generally sufficient for most level flight except very low speeds and high boost/rpm.
  • At high speed 35% Radiator and Oil cooler open is generally sufficient.
  • Slow speed is the worse situation. Sustained slow speed high power manoeuvring with < half rads should be avoided.

LIMITATIONS

  • Max IAS 750Kmh
  • Max Flap Speed 250Kmh
  • Max Coolant Temp 100C
  • Max Oil Temp 105C
